Bozeman Montessori is accepting applications and interviewing for full-time Montessori Guide positions and Assistant Guide positions supporting our seasoned Montessori guides. Montessori experience is a plus, and we also provide on-the-job training. We have classrooms serving infants (6 months to 18 months,) toddlers (18 months to 3 years), and primary (3 years to 6 years old).
